Arcana of bondage, temptation and the hidden contract


The Devil is not evil.
The Devil is attachment.
If Death completes what is exhausted,
The Devil reveals why you remain bound.
The meaning of The Devil Tarot card is not punishment.
It is exposure.
The Devil Arcana shows where desire has become stronger than freedom, where attachment has turned into dependency, and where an energetic contract still governs your choices.
This Arcana does not destroy.
It binds — until you become aware.
The Energy of the Devil Arcana
The energy of The Devil is dense, magnetic and heated.
It manifests as:
— obsessive attraction
— emotional, sexual or material dependency
— fear of loss
— control disguised as love
— repeating toxic patterns
— invisible energetic attachments
In spiritual practice, The Devil Arcana signals shadow work and the need to confront hidden agreements you have made with fear.
Unlike Death, which severs,
The Devil holds.
It feeds on unconscious desire.
Light Aspect — Lumen
In the Lumen line, The Devil represents conscious desire.
It activates when:
— you recognize the chain
— you admit the attachment without denial
— you reclaim personal authority
— you transform craving into power
In Lumen, temptation becomes choice.
Desire remains, but it no longer controls you.
This is liberation through awareness.
Shadow Aspect — Ignis
In the Ignis line, The Devil becomes the fire of dependency.
It manifests as:
— obsession
— jealousy
— manipulation
— fear of abandonment
— energetic parasitism
— emotional volatility
Ignis reveals where fear is stronger than consciousness.
If resisted blindly, the chain tightens.
If confronted honestly, the contract dissolves.
Meditation on The Devil Arcana
Entry into the Arcana
Meditation on The Devil Tarot card is a practice of shadow confrontation.
Place the card before you.
Dim the light.
Sit upright and breathe steadily.
Step 1 — Name the Chain
Say aloud:
“My chain is…”
Be specific. A person. A habit. Validation. Control. Power. Pleasure.
Clarity weakens illusion.
Step 2 — Locate the Hook in the Body
Where does it live?
— throat
— solar plexus
— lower abdomen
— chest
The Devil Arcana always manifests through the body before it manifests through events.
Step 3 — Expose the Contract
Ask:
What do I receive from this attachment?
What do I sacrifice?
Every dependency is an exchange of energy.
Until the contract is named, it remains active.
Step 4 — Reclaim Authority
Say:
“I see the contract. I reclaim my power.”
Do not dramatize.
Do not attack the chain.
Witness it.
Awareness breaks unconscious control.
Ritual of Energetic Release
Repeat three times:
“I acknowledge the desire. I remove the hook. I reclaim my authority.”
Within 72 hours, take one concrete external action:
— limit contact
— delete a trigger
— stop a compulsive behavior
— establish a boundary
— close what keeps you bound
Without action, the Devil remains theoretical.
Signs of Lumen Activation
— calm clarity
— reduced obsession
— grounded passion
— restored personal power
Signs of Ignis Domination
— panic
— jealousy
— craving
— emotional swings
— attempts to regain control
If The Devil appears repeatedly in spiritual work, deeper shadow integration is required.
When Not to Enter The Devil Arcana
Do not activate this Arcana:
— when emotionally unstable
— when acting from revenge
— when driven by chaos
First stability.
Then confrontation.
The Devil does not create chains.
It reveals them.
The meaning of The Devil Arcana lies in conscious liberation through shadow work and awareness.
Freedom begins where illusion ends.
